Two Medical Colleges Snap Up Former Hospital in Westwood for $45M
May 14, 2008

Hackensack University Medical Center and Touro University College of Medicine have just completed the acquisition of the former site of Pascack Valley Hospital in Westwood, New Jersey, in a deal valued at $45 million. Pascack filed for bankruptcy last year, leaving the disposition of its assets in the hands of the U.S. Bankruptcy Court, which relied on Cushman & Wakefield's Metropolitan Area Capital Markets Group to help secure a buyer for the property. The 20-acre property is located in an affluent area of Westwood, about 25 miles north of Jersey City and New York City. HUMC and TouroMed plan to open a medical school at the former 251-bed acute care facility. .
